I checked out this popular local taco shop several friends swear by the location. So here we go. Location, easily accessible and a decent drive through. It's best aspect of location is all the nearby apartments. The area is really gross and dirty though with urine stains everywhere. The food, I got the Victoria burrito which is carnitas and chili releno. Small for the price, almost half the size of other locations for the price of around $9. The flavor was pretty good and the combination is pretty fresh. There was a big chuck of gristle inThe burrito though. The staff, the guy who works the window was cool, and helpful. The extras, the green salsa was basically just green water and the only have green and red salsa, no habenero or spicy option. The menu is also pretty diverse and an easy walk up window. Results, I might eat there if I lived near there, if they had a nearby bar or nightlife I could see it being very popular. Aside from that there are taco shops on every block and this one just didn't stand out.
